4.3. Description of components and power supply terminals.
Table 1. Components of the Power supply PCB (Fig. 2).

Description
[1]
PANEL – optical indication connector
[2]
BUZZER – acoustic
indication (section 7.2.2)
[3]
V
EXT
jumper
– polarization of the EXTi circuit
(section 6.6)
[4]
F
BAT
– fuse in the battery circuit,
F10A / 250V
[5]
F
AUX1
– fuse in the AUX1 output circuit,
F6,3A / 250V
[6]
F
AUX2
– fuse in the AUX2 output circuit,
F6,3A / 250V
[7]
SERIAL – communication port
[8]
Z2 jumper temporary lock of the battery test
(section 8.5)
[9]
OVP
– overvoltage protection optical indication
(section 6.9)
[10]
LEDs – optical indication:
AC
– AC power
AUX1 – AUX1 output voltage
AUX2 – AUX2 output voltage
OVL
– PSU overload
APS
– battery failure
PSU
– PSU failure
ALARM – collective failure
EXTi
– EXTi input status
EXTo
– EXTo relay output status
LB
– battery charging
[11]
Terminals:
~AC~ – AC power input
EPS FLT – technical output of AC power failure indication
open
= AC power failure
close
= AC power - O.K.
PSU FLT – technical output of PSU failure indication
open
= failure
close
= PSU operation - O.K.
APS FLT – technical output of battery failure
open
= battery failure
close
= battery status - O.K.
ALARM – technical output of collective failure
open
= failure
close
= O.K.
EXTo – controlled relay output
EXTi
– input of collective failure
+BAT- – battery power output
+AUX1- – AUX1 power output
(+AUX1= +U, -AUX=GND)
+AUX2- – AUX2 power output
(+AUX2= +U, -AUX=GND)
[12}
TAMPER – antisabotage protection microswitch connector (section 6.7)
[13]
Connector– for connecting the EMC filter
